Output dfc8ec2a632a8437376b30689ba6b9b8d22cf32c1a3be3581ed23259c101164c:1

value
835457
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ed8d20ec3de66de02d0a360db412e8a71407921b OP_EQUAL
address
3PM58o4PtkvphnA1PUtxwRVjfeQeX4Ln9M
transaction
dfc8ec2a632a8437376b30689ba6b9b8d22cf32c1a3be3581ed23259c101164c
spent
true